WebOct 13, 2024 · Sirius: second brightest star — the brightest star in the night sky. The second brightest star, Sirius, has an apparent magnitude of -1.46 and is visible worldwide. This dazzling star is located in the constellation Canis Major; it is the Alpha star of this constellation. Sirius is about 8.6 light-years away from us, which is much closer than ... WebBrightest Galaxies in the Night Sky. 1) Andromeda Galaxy. The Andromeda galaxy is one of the brightest objects in the night sky, one of the largest known galaxies in the … WebSep 8, 2024 · Among the night sky’s most beautiful features is the Andromeda Galaxy, one of the several galaxies that sit in the same group of galaxies as the Milky Way (known as the Local Group). This galaxy is the brightest one that is visible to the naked human eye and also the closest spiral galaxy, sitting extremely close to the Milky Way.
